Entrance Hall
5.36m x 0.74m plus recess.
With doors leading to lounge, kitchen, both bedrooms, shower room / W.C, and having a storage cupboard.
Lounge
4.57m x 3.89m max.
With double-glazed window to side, coving to ceiling, and feature electric fire.
Kitchen
2.9m x 2.5m max.
With double-glazed window to side and fitted with a comprehensive range of wall and base units with complementary work-surfaces and tiled splash-backs, one-and-a-half bowl stainless-steel sink-drainer unit with mixer tap over, gas/electric cooker point, plumbing for a washing machine, ceiling spotlight and tile-effect flooring.
Bedroom 1
3.53m x 3.53m max.
With double-glazed window to side and fitted wardrobes.
Bedroom 2
3.9m x 2.97m max.
With double-glazed window to side and fitted wardrobes.
Shower / WC
2.36m x 1.47m max.
With obscured double-glazed window to side and fitted with a three-piece shower suite comprising enclosed shower cubicle, low-level flush W.C, and sink set into storage cabinet, the whole having tiled walls and tiled flooring, coving to ceiling, and spotlights.
Garden
The property has a large rear garden with patio area and potting shed, and a further gravelled area with stepping stones, small lawn to rear, and fenced boundaries.
